About Welcome to Lilllydale

Download the app and take a walk up and down Main Street, Between Lilydale Station and Olinda Creek. the street will welcome you as you walk about. This experience was developed by the LAWS (Lilllydale Alternative Welcoming Society) -- look for us at our space near the train station, during September 2017!
